Iran halts military operations against Israel; Israel continues strikes in Lebanon after ceasefire

alarabiyaaljazeeraapnews.comblueskydwhindustantimes.comstraitstimes.comtheconversation.com · 5 blocs · 29d ago

Iran halted its military operations against Israel, warning that strikes would resume if Israel attacked Lebanon. Israel continued military operations in southern Lebanon, claiming these actions are separate from the Iran ceasefire. A ceasefire agreement between Lebanon and Israel was announced in Washington after talks between officials from both countries, with Hezbollah excluded from the deal.

Iran halted its military operations against Israel, according to multiple corroborated reports. Iran warned that its strikes against Israel would resume if Israel attacked Lebanon. Israel continued military operations in southern Lebanon after the Iran-Israel ceasefire was declared. A ceasefire agreement between Lebanon and Israel was announced in Washington after talks between Lebanese and Israeli officials. Hezbollah is not a party to the Lebanon-Israel ceasefire agreement, according to corroborated reports.

Israel claimed its Lebanon strikes are separate from the Iran ceasefire. Israel has conducted thousands of strikes in Lebanon since April. Israel intends to maintain a military presence in southern Lebanon. Israel's Defence Minister Israel Katz stated that the US-brokered ceasefire with Lebanon grants Israel the freedom to strike Beirut if Hezbollah attacks Israeli communities, according to HindustanTimes.com. Hezbollah claimed to have launched rockets and drones at Israeli forces in southern Lebanon before the ceasefire was announced, according to HindustanTimes.com. Hezbollah has not commented on the Lebanon-Israel ceasefire agreement, according to StraitsTimes.com.

A UN peacekeeper was killed and two others were injured when mortar shells hit their position near Marjayoun in southeastern Lebanon, according to HindustanTimes.com. Al Jazeera reported that an Israeli drone targeted a vehicle despite a ceasefire being in place, according to HindustanTimes.com. Israeli strikes in southern Lebanon resulted in over 254 deaths and 800+ injuries, according to TheConversation.com.

Donald Trump called for an end to the fighting between Israel and Iran, according to DW. Donald Trump warned that U.S. strikes on Iran would resume if Iran did not comply with the ceasefire, according to TheConversation.com.
